Unleashing Your Blender's Potential: Crafting Unique Outdoor Recipes

When heading outdoors for camping, tailgating, or road trips, a blender might not be the first tool you consider packing. Yet, a trusty blender opens a world of creative cooking possibilities well beyond the typical smoothie. From fresh salsas and soups to nutritious spreads and even cocktails, modern portable blenders empower travelers and outdoor adventurers to prepare tasty, easy recipes that elevate any outdoor meal.

Understanding the Versatility of Blenders for Outdoor Use

The Rise of Portable Blenders

Traditional blenders often conjure images of bulky kitchen appliances. However, the advent of compact, battery-operated, or USB-chargeable portable blenders has transformed our expectations. These devices are designed to travel light yet deliver powerful performance for camping meal prep and travel cooking alike.

Blender Types Suitable for the Outdoors

Choosing the right blender type is critical. Hardwired models with higher wattage deliver smoother blends but require power sources, while cordless blenders sacrifice some power for portability. For multi-day trips, consider models with long-lasting batteries or those compatible with portable power stations.

Beyond Smoothies: Unlocking Blender Dishes

Blenders aren’t just for smoothies. Outdoor enthusiasts can prepare blended soups, sauces, dips, and even pancake batters. Exploring the full range of blender dishes enhances meal variety without bulky kitchenware, solving common travel cooking challenges.

Creative Cooking: Unique Outdoor Blender Recipes to Try

Hearty Camping Soups

Creating a warm and nourishing soup using fresh or dried ingredients only requires blending and heating. A blender easily purees cooked vegetables like butternut squash or tomato, along with herbs, spices, and broth. These easy recipes provide comfort after a long day hiking or outdoor activities.

Fresh-Pressed Sauces and Dips

Imagine whipping together a vibrant salsa, guacamole, or creamy hummus with a portable blender right at your campsite or picnic spot. Blending fresh tomatoes, chiles, or avocados with lime and cilantro creates instant flavor boosters to complement grilled dishes or chips.

Energy-Boosting Nut Butters and Smoothies

For active travelers, preparing homemade almond or peanut butter blends offers a healthier boost than packaged alternatives. Combine nuts and a touch of honey or salt in your blender. Pair with fresh fruit smoothies rich in protein and greens for balanced energy throughout the day.

Blender Kitchen Hacks for Outdoor Efficiency

Prepping Ingredients in Advance

To save time outdoors, prepare and pre-chop harder ingredients at home before blending onsite to minimize cleanup and processing time. Store in sealed containers or freezer bags for freshness.

Maximizing Battery Efficiency

Charge your blender fully before leaving, and consider solar or USB power banks for recharge during longer excursions. Rotate blending tasks to conserve power, blending multiple items in one session when possible.

Cleaning Made Simple

Use quick-clean techniques by blending warm water and a few drops of biodegradable soap, then rinsing well. This minimizes water use and keeps your outdoor setup hygienic.

Blender Recipe Ideas for Specific Outdoor Scenarios

Camping Meal Prep

From chilled gazpacho to protein pancake batter, blenders greatly expand camping meal options. Portable blenders also help in making quick energy gels or fresh fruit mixes to fuel hiking.

Beach Day Refreshments and Snacks

Shake up tropical smoothies, blended frozen fruit popsicles, or creamy avocado dressings perfect for light beach lunches. These easy recipes keep you cool in the sun.

Tailgating and Picnic Enhancements

Mix flavored dips, cocktail margaritas, or creamy salads in minutes. Blenders make entertaining outdoors seamless, complementing grilled meats or snack assortments.

Essential Accessories for Outdoor Blender Success

Durable Blender Bottles and Jars

Select BPA-free, shatter-resistant containers to withstand outdoor use and travel bumps. Some models offer travel lids and straws for convenience.

Safety and Maintenance Tips for Outdoor Blender Use

Proper Handling and Storage

Keep your blender dry and clean when not in use. Avoid exposure to extreme temperatures to maintain motor and battery health.
